But understanding this Kelley Blue Book secret isn’t about flashy tricks or hidden deals—it’s about powering smarter decisions with accurate, data-driven insights. ### Why Used Cars Suck—And Why That Suddenly Doesn’t Have To Be Your Reality The used car market has long been seen as a maze. With thousands of options, inconsistent quality, and hidden fees, the process often feels unpredictable. Buyers face steep learning curves: reading vehicle history reports, assessing depreciation risks, and negotiating with dealer incentives that aren’t always transparent. High resale uncertainty, older vehicles with outdated tech, and lack of real-time price benchmarks compound the frustration.
